Colonial Manor Neighborhood Overview

Overview

Colonial Manor is a quiet, residential neighborhood in the northern part of Baltimore, MD. Known for its tree-lined streets and strong sense of community, it offers a suburban feel while remaining within the city limits.

Housing & Real Estate

The neighborhood primarily features spacious single-family homes, many with classic colonial architecture. The real estate market is stable, with a median home value of approximately $443,200, reflecting its desirability.

Schools & Education

Families in Colonial Manor are served by Baltimore City Public Schools, with several well-regarded elementary and middle schools in the area. The neighborhood's proximity to colleges like Loyola University Maryland and Johns Hopkins is also a notable asset.

Parks & Recreation

Residents enjoy easy access to nearby Lake Roland Park, which offers trails, a dog park, and scenic water views. The neighborhood itself is walkable, with several small community green spaces and playgrounds.

Local Dining & Shopping

While mostly residential, Colonial Manor is a short drive from the shops and restaurants of nearby Towson and the Falls Road corridor. Daily needs are met by local grocers and a variety of casual eateries and cafes.

Who Lives Here

The neighborhood is popular with established families, professionals, and long-time residents. With a median household income around $127,055, it is one of Baltimore's more affluent communities.
